Dublin, Jan. 22, 2026 (GLOBE NEWSWIRE) — The “Needle Free Diabetes Care Market – Global Forecast 2026-2032” has been added to ResearchAndMarkets.com’s offering.
The Needle Free Diabetes Care Market has displayed significant growth, evolving from USD 12.88 billion in 2025 to USD 13.61 billion in 2026, with projections to reach USD 19.88 billion by 2032 at a CAGR of 6.39%. The emergence of needle-free diabetes care is revolutionizing the management of chronic diseases by facilitating less invasive, more convenient care aligned with patient behaviors. Enhanced delivery platforms are seeking to reduce procedural burdens linked to subcutaneous injections while addressing adherence challenges in gestational, type 1, and type 2 diabetes. Through a blend of drug-device integration, materials science, and user-centered design, innovations are reshaping patient experiences.

Technological Innovations in Diabetes Care
The evolving landscape of needle-free diabetes care is being shaped by technology, policy adjustments, and shifting patient expectations. Advancements in delivery mechanisms, such as jet injectors, microneedle platforms, and patch pumps, enhance options for developers. These are distinguished by their physical action mechanisms, production complexity, and integration possibilities for biologics. Stakeholders expect ease of use, especially for populations with adherence barriers. End-user environments are also adapting; the expansion of home care increases the demand for nonprofessional administration devices compatible with remote monitoring, offering a competitive advantage in the market.
Regulatory and Reimbursement Shifts
Regulatory and reimbursement frameworks are evolving to adapt to novel device categories. Authorities are clarifying pathways for combination drug-device products, which now must include user experience and real-world adherence metrics alongside conventional clinical endpoints. Payers are similarly focused on value propositions linking adherence improvements and reduced complication rates to cost-of-care reductions. These shifts mandate that developers synchronize product designs with lifecycle plans covering clinical validation, reimbursement strategy, and distribution optimization.
